Can I Name my Poodle after a City or Location?

Yes, you can name your poodle after a city or location that holds significance to you. However, there are some legal considerations to keep in mind. In some countries, there are rules and regulations governing pet names, such as restrictions on offensive or vulgar names. It’s always a good idea to check with your local authorities or pet registration organizations to ensure that your chosen name complies with the rules.

Best Practices: Choosing a Name for Your Poodle

When choosing a name for your poodle, it’s important to keep a few best practices in mind. Here are some tips to help you choose a memorable and meaningful name:

  • Choose a name that is easy to pronounce and remember.
  • Avoid names that sound too similar to common commands, such as "sit" or "stay."
  • Consider the gender of your pet when choosing a name.
  • Make sure the name is appropriate for all ages and occasions.
  • Avoid choosing a name that is too similar to other pets in the household.
